On Wednesday, the United Nations Security Council issued a resolution urging the Houthi to cease their assaults on commercial vessels in the Red Sea promptly. The resolution also called for the release of the Galaxy Leader and its crew, who were abducted by the Houthi on November 19. The Houthi responded, asserting that they would continue their attacks in the Red Sea until Israel permitted unrestricted humanitarian aid shipments to Qaza.
Meanwhile, Reuters stated that Iran halted its crude oil exports to China with the intention of selling it at more lucrative prices. Concurrently, the Energy Information Administration of the USA forecasted that despite a slowdown in global economic growth, American crude oil production would reach its peak in 2024. Additionally, OPEC lowered its production levels in a bid to boost crude oil prices.
Crude Oil Market Fluctuations
Simultaneously, on January 9, crude oil prices experienced a 3% decline attributed to Saudi Arabia offering a discount to its Asian customers. By Thursday, crude oil reached approximately 78 USD per barrel, while Singapore’s HSFO CST180 and bitumen closed at 437 USD and 430 USD, respectively. In South Korea, the bitumen price rose by 5 dollars, settling at 380 USD, while Bahrain’s bitumen price remained steady at 400 USD for the third consecutive month. European regions witnessed price fluctuations within the range of 370-470 USD.
On January 1, Indian refineries lowered bitumen prices by approximately 20 USD. The direction for the second half of January remains uncertain, but there is a likelihood of prices either falling or remaining stable.
